Latest Patents

Among Lovett's most recent innovations is the patent for the "Cloned Leptospira outer membrane protein." This invention presents an antigenic preparation consisting of a 31 Kd outer membrane protein from Leptospira, which serves as a potential vaccine for leptospirosis. Additionally, he has developed methods for isolating rare outer membrane proteins from T. pallidum, specifically targeting antigenic proteins of the Spirochaetaceae family. This groundbreaking process utilizes a discontinuous Ficoll gradient separation to extract and identify these proteins, providing vital information for the diagnosis and prophylaxis of syphilis.
